At Dr Sknn, we offer an advanced Fractional CO2 Laser treatment that can tighten and firm up loose skin. This treatment stimulates the production of new dermis and epidermis through ablation and thermal effect. With our specifically designed mid-infrared CO2 laser at 10,600 nm, spaced-out pulses spare the tissue in-between and promote a rapid recovery. Our laser treatment is highly effective in treating a variety of skin problems such as wrinkles, dyschromia, pigmented lesions, enlarged pores, skin surface irregularities, sun damage, stretch marks, and sagging skin. This treatment can bring about a healthy, youthful and glowing complexion, thickness, and hydration. At Dr Sknn, we strive to help you gain tighter and firmer skin and enhance your self-confidence.

Why Choose Dr Sknn for Laser Skin Tightening

At Dr Sknn, a consultation is carried out prior to any Fractional CO2 Laser treatment, wherein a complete medical history will be taken and a physical examination, including photos, will be done. You can address any worries, hopes, outcomes or queries you may have during this consultation. Before the treatment, the post-treatment advice and any potential risks associated with the Fractional CO2 Laser treatment will be completely gone through with you and a consent form will be signed to make sure that you understand the procedure clearly. If you are having a particular area treated for the first time, a trial patch may be done to decide suitability. In addition, if your skin type is identified as III+, a topical serum may need to be applied for four weeks before the treatment to ready your skin. At Dr Sknn, safety and suitability for treatment are of the highest importance, and a full consultation will be conducted to guarantee your eligibility for the Fractional CO2 Laser treatment. If the trial patch shows no signs after 48 hours, the treatment can be administered. Nevertheless, if any medications are identified in your medical history, the patch testing period may need to be extended to a maximum of two weeks. Meanwhile, if your skin type is III+, a topical product may be necessary for four weeks prior to the treatment.
